Respondents PRAYER: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India for issuance of Writ of Mandamus, directing the respondent No.1 to dispose the appeal preferred by the petitioner dated 06.04.2024 and 13.08.2024 u/s. 12 of Tamil Nadu Patta Pass Book Act within the time stipulated by this Court. ORDER

Aggrieved by the fact that the appeal preferred as early as on 06.04.2024 and renewed on 13.08.2024 under Section 12 of the Tamil Nadu Patta Passbook Act, has not been disposed of, the petitioner has approached this Court for issuance of writ of Mandamus, directing the first respondent to dispose of the appeal preferred by the petitioner dated 06.04.2024 and 13.08.2024.

2. It appears that the petitioner had made a representation on 06.04.2024 and 12.04.2024 to conduct an enquiry and to cancel the patta for restoring the Government poramboke land in S.Nos.97/2, 97/3 and 97/4 at Utharapuli Village, P.Udayarenthal Revenue Group, Kalaiyarkovil Taluk, Sivagangai District and the first respondent had not conducted an enquiry to date. That apart, the first respondent has not even taken note of the earlier patta cancellation order passed by the Revenue Divisional Officer. The petitioner has filed an appeal under Section 12 of the Tamil Nadu Patta Passbook Act before the first respondent on 13.08.2024 and no enquiry has been conducted on the appeal. 2/4

3. Hence, a Mandamus is issued to the first respondent to dispose of the appeal preferred by the petitioner dated 06.04.2024 and 13.08.2024 within a period of 4 we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.

4. With the aforesaid direction, the Writ Petition stands disposed of. No costs.
